County house prices at a four-year high

House prices in the county have risen to their highest level for almost four years.

Latest figures from the Government’s Land Registry show the average cost of a home was £241,290 in May, up 0.8 per cent on the previous month.

The last time prices were as high was in August 2008 when it was £241,334.

Overall, prices have risen by 1.9 per cent for the year to date and have gone up consistently for the last five months.

Nationally, the average price of a property is £161,677, up 0.5 per cent on the previous month.
